Output 86b555ef5374d5579e6dfe3dbd6a395741ddad0a6a8ec2c0b4ab33563c18e7aa:4

value
30968142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aa95e5c926fdc6c25c0c5515669c7cdcf5b3c78 OP_EQUAL
address
MDFLKVYffo28u2RLQCnsS6y7Xcd995h4GD
transaction
86b555ef5374d5579e6dfe3dbd6a395741ddad0a6a8ec2c0b4ab33563c18e7aa
spent
true